Output 51f8a026b78c87f279f3a84a96957309ab61b3f6d6464ba446fd798afe8bebde:124

value
67118
script pubkey
OP_0 OP_PUSHBYTES_20 16d45b46559e6c14db2b8d9de6fc577efaf63fa2
address
bc1qzm29k3j4nekpfket3kw7dlzh0ma0v0azw6d30w
transaction
51f8a026b78c87f279f3a84a96957309ab61b3f6d6464ba446fd798afe8bebde